- Machine Learning (ML): Teaching machines with data so they can learn without being heavily programmed. For example, YouTube suggesting videos based on your watch history.
- Deep Learning: This uses artificial neural networks that copy the human brain to handle highly complex tasks, like self-driving cars and medical cancer detection.
- Natural Language Processing (NLP): This helps machines understand and reply to human language. Voice assistants like Google and customer service chatbots use NLP.
- Computer Vision: Gives machines the power to "see" and understand images. Smartphone cameras automatically detecting a flower or security cameras recognizing faces are great examples.
- Robotics: Makes physical machines smart, like the automatic robots used in Amazon warehouses for packing and moving goods.
- Healthcare: AI can quickly analyze medical images (like X-rays or MRIs) to detect diseases like cancer and heart issues in minutes with great accuracy.
- Education: Platforms like Byju's and Coursera use AI to give students personalized learning experiences based on their individual strengths and weaknesses.
- Finance: Banks use AI to detect account fraud instantly, and the stock market uses it to predict share prices.
- Agriculture: Drones and sensors monitor crop health, weather, and water needs to help farmers make better decisions and increase profits.
- Space & Defense: AI analyzes satellite data for new space discoveries and controls autonomous drones to keep soldiers safe during missions.

- Data Privacy: AI uses our personal search and location data. If this data falls into the wrong hands, our privacy is at risk.
- Job Losses: Machines are taking over jobs like driving, delivery, and basic customer service, which can cause unemployment.
- Misuse: If used for wrong purposes, AI can be very dangerous. Examples include creating fake "deepfake" videos or launching cyber attacks.
